The College Work-Study Program is a federally funded financial aid program whose purpose is to stimulate and promote part-time employment for students in need of earnings to finance their educational expenses. Work-study jobs are not intended to replace existing staff positions.

How does this affect me?

Some jobs are designated as "work-study" and only qualifying students (those with work-study in their financial aid package) may apply. Most jobs however do not have this restriction. For more information on work-study, please visit the Office of Financial Aid.

How do I check if I have been awarded work-study?

  • Go to http://stuinfo.msu.edu

  • Login using your MSU NetID (everything before @ in your MSU e-mail address) and e-mail password. (For example, sparty would be the NetID for sparty@msu.edu.) Click "Login".

  • Under Financial Aid, click "eFinaid (Check Your Aid)".

  • Click "Step 4" to view your financial aid. The next page will list types and amounts of financial aid you qualify for. If you have Work-Study, it will be listed under AID PROGRAM as one of the following: MCH Mich Work-Study Grad, MCH Mich Work-Study Ungr, or FED College Work-Study

NOTE: "Student Employment" does not mean you have work-study. Visit the Office of Financial Aid to learn about the difference between Student Employment and Work-Study.
